32 /// Exempt pointer for RCU
34 This special pointer class is intended for returning extracted node from RCU-based container.
35 The destructor (and \p release() member function) invokes <tt>RCU::retire_ptr< Disposer >()</tt> function to dispose the node.
36 For non-intrusive containers from \p cds::container namespace \p Disposer is an invocation
37 of node deallocator. For intrusive containers the disposer can be empty or it can trigger an event "node can be reused safely".
38 In any case, the exempt pointer concept keeps RCU semantics.
40 You don't need use this helper class directly. Any RCU-based container defines a proper typedef for this template.
43 - \p RCU - one of \ref cds_urcu_gc "RCU type"
44 - \p NodeType - container's node type
45 - \p ValueType - value type stored in container's node. For intrusive containers it is the same as \p NodeType
46 - \p Disposer - a disposer functor
47 - \p Cast - a functor for casting from \p NodeType to \p ValueType. Usually, for intrusive containers \p Cast may be \p void.
